📍 Beijing | 💼 Principal Software Engineering Manager @ Microsoft
Reinventing the developer experience by engineering my own evolution first. 15-year Microsoft veteran, now leading my team's AI transformation by writing code, not just memos.
- Building Copilot & Bing - Mobile app development at Microsoft, shipping AI-powered experiences to millions
- Exploring AI Coding - Experimenting with agentic engineering and open source tools in my spare time (My VibeUsage)
- Writing on lizheng.me - Sharing thoughts on AI, coding, and the future of software development
- 🚀 Echo - API-only IP lookup service built with Bun and TypeScript
- 🧭 Deca - Local-first macOS control gateway for AI agents with Elysia API and a debug console
- ⏰ Runner - Declarative task scheduler for macOS that runs AI jobs via launchd and opencode
- 🔍 X-Ray - Twitter/X monitoring system that generates AI-written Markdown insight reports
- 🔗 Zhe - TypeScript URL shortener with clean links and analytics-ready storage
- 📰 GeekHub - Self-hosted RSS reader with AI summarization and translation, built with Next.js
- 💰 Noheir - Personal finance tracker for income, expenses, and assets with analytics dashboards
- 📊 InfoViz - Information visualization library
- 🛠️ InfoViz Builder - Visual creator for InfoViz charts
- 📱 InfoViz Mobile - Mobile version of InfoViz
- ⚡ JSInst - JavaScript instrumentation and performance toolkit
- 🔌 NodeHub - A hub for Node.js services
- 📄 Doc-Doctor - Study abroad document service platform
- 🎨 Huran.cc - Art e-commerce platform connecting artists with collectors
- Why You Shouldn't PUA AI Models
- Why I Don't Like "Vibe Coding"
- Why AI's Future Still Depends on Google, Microsoft and Apple
- Quality vs Quantity in AI Coding
- The Vanishing Stairs: How Juniors Cross the Experience Gap in the AI Era
"己立立人,己达达人;己所不欲,勿施于人。"




